
Helping women develop comprehensively and build happy families starts with supporting members in economic development, poverty reduction and improving the quality of life. The Provincial Women's Union has chaired and effectively implemented the movements "Helping poor women have addresses" and "Women doing good business", helping thousands of members confidently rise up and escape poverty sustainably. In the period of 2021-2025, the Union at all levels coordinated to help 1,790 poor, near-poor and disadvantaged women's households rise up and escape poverty. Along with that, nearly 118,000 women's households have access to social policy credit capital, with a total capital of over 3,450 billion VND. More than 55 training courses, vocational training, science and technology transfer, and start-up were organized; helping about 1,300 women have stable jobs.
The movement to support women in starting a business continues to be promoted, opening up a more sustainable development direction for women. Notably, Project 939 "Supporting women in starting a business in the period 2017-2025" has been effectively implemented by the Women's Union at all levels. Thereby, 120 training courses have been organized for nearly 10,000 women, supporting the development of more than 400 ideas and start-up projects; nearly 200 women's households have been helped with loans, legal advice, brand building, and product promotion. Many competitions and festivals have been organized enthusiastically, such as: "Creative women start-ups to promote local resources", "Creative women start-ups and green transformation"... Hundreds of new models have been born, contributing to job creation, increasing income, and reducing the unemployment rate in the province to only 2.1%.
Implementing Project 01 "Supporting cooperatives managed by women, creating jobs for female workers by 2030", from 2023 to now, the Women's Union at all levels has organized 12 conferences, trained more than 800 people; consulted and supported the establishment of 12 cooperatives and 11 cooperative groups managed by women. Agricultural and food processing cooperatives managed by women have brought income and created jobs for hundreds of female workers, especially in rural and mountainous areas.

Quang Ninh women are also equipped with knowledge and skills to master their lives through Project 938 "Propaganda, education, mobilization, and support for women to participate in solving a number of social issues related to women in the period 2017-2027". Many models have been effectively implemented such as "Educating parents in child care and education", "Safety for women and children", "Practical actions for women and children"... Many training and communication courses have been deployed to help women improve their legal awareness and skills to respond to situations of violence, abuse, and protect children and themselves.
With Project 8 "Implementing gender equality and solving urgent issues for women and children", Quang Ninh is one of the most effective localities in the country. Up to now, the province has established 71 community communication teams, 56 "Leaders of Change" Clubs, organized 200 communication sessions, 20 training courses with nearly 10,000 participants. Many products and creative models of ethnic minority children have won high prizes at national competitions. Models such as "Community Communication Team" and "Leaders of Change" Club have become highlights, welcomed, replicated, creating clear changes in awareness and behavior, contributing to eliminating gender stereotypes, promoting gender equality, building safe, prosperous and happy families.
From 2023, the Provincial Women's Union will continue to implement Project 1889 on improving nutrition and physical strength for children in mountainous and ethnic minority areas. The project will be implemented in 64 disadvantaged communes, focusing on 16 communes with the highest malnutrition rates in the province. To date, the Union has established 21 models for child care and education, organized 118 training classes, 8 competitions, and distributed 14,000 propaganda leaflets. The rate of underweight and stunted children has decreased significantly; the awareness of pregnant women and mothers with young children about nutrition and health care has improved.
Along with movement activities, the work of training cadres is considered the foundation for a strong organization of the Union. Implementing Project 1893 "Training cadres and civil servants of the Women's Union at all levels and Women's Union Branch Chairmen for the period 2019-2025", the whole province has organized 220 training courses for nearly 20,000 cadres, innovating flexible learning methods, combining direct and online learning. 100% of the current Women's Union cadres are proficient in IT skills, applying digital technology in their work.
